💰 M&A Advisory
Back in 2016, the New York Times acquired the product review / affiliate site The Wirecutter for $30MM - it was one of the biggest ever acquisitions in our space. As you can see in the Ahrefs screenshot below, over the last 3+ years it went well for them, growing from 1.5MM organic visits to over 5MM in April 2020.
However, it looks like it may have been hit by the May Google core update which could be a reason why they have now amalgamated it into the New York Times - although Ahrefs has admitted it’s been having a traffic estimation bug so take that with a grain of salt. The official statement says it’s because:
By moving to nytimes.com, we’ll be able to reach and help even more readers
In other M&A news, many Amazon associate site owners that got badly hit by the April commission reductions, have been testing out new affiliate networks. One of those has been the UK-based “commerce content monetization platform” for publishers Skimlinks which just got acquired by Connexity. As the CEO, Bill Glass states:
Our solutions help retailers acquire new customers and sales while enabling ecommerce-oriented publishers to monetize engaged shopping audiences. Combining the companies creates more scale on both sides of the marketplace.

😞 Exit ROI
Interesting tweet from David Holmes on fees and taxes when selling a website. It reminded me of an article on the Fat Stacks blog where Jon Dykstra stated that you may realize that a $1MM sale price will not be enough for you to retire.
My previous UK accountant (now on number three) made me take an exit as regular income (rather than capital gains which is taxed lower) as said that this is what my company does. She didn’t realize that individual websites are acquired and sold as assets (good recent post by Laurent Truc from MadX Capital).

🌴 Lifestyle Business > Website Investor
I first heard Jase Rodley on the Tropical MBA podcast back in 2018 talking about the 40% rule - swapping 4% retirement drawdowns for 40% semi-retirement yields from actively investing and operating content sites. It inspired me to write my How to Snowball $100k into $1MM within 3 Years post. As he states in his Freedom Fund post:
[I]nvesting in websites is a way to get that same $250k per year with $625k instead of $6.25 million.
He’s just updated his Lifestyle Business post where he has added becoming an investor as one of the options. Just make sure you live in an expensive enough place to not get caught in the coconut cash conundrum.
